GOLF

REEFTON CLUB. The following is the order of play for the first round of championships: On Friday, 24th inst.—Mrs McVicar v. Mrs Buist, Mrs Kane v. Mrs Wicken, Mrs Sharpe v. Mrs Duff, Mrs Patterson v. Mrs Yellowlees . On Saturday, 25th inst.—Mrs Findlay v. Miss Farrell, Mrs Eklund v. Miss King. The medal match played on September 11 resulted: Miss King, gross score 94, Mrs Wicken, net score 79. The order for the junior championship is as follows (to be played on Friday): Mrs Morris v. Mrs Cereseto, Miss Watson v. Mrs Hayes, Mrs Crossman v. Miss Kane. On 25th inst. — Miss McVicar v. Miss Peters. N.Z. TASMAN CUP TEAM. AUCKLAND, September 21. The Executive Council of the New Zealand Ladies’ Golf Union announces that the following have been selected to represent New Zealand against Australia in the match for the Tasman Cup at Napier on October 6:— Miss J. Betts (Nelson), Mrs. R. S. Fullerton-Smith (Marton), Miss P. P. Helean (Napier), Mrs. G. W. Hollis (Hawera), Miss J. Horwell (Timaru). Mrs. Guy Williams (Wellington), will be non-playing captain.
